蒙古族传统家具三维模型数据库的构建

2017-03-17 16:32张世铮包丽梅
电脑知识与技术 2016年32期

张世铮++包丽梅

摘要:该文在搜集、整理现有蒙古族传统家具图案的基础上,利用计算机图形学、数字图像处理、AutoCAD和三维动画设计的方法,对所收集的资料利用AutoCAD完成二维图案的创建,利用3DS MAX创建三维模型,让图案研究者很方便的、直观的观看家具模型和三维装饰图案。通过建立数据库,可以方便查询和导出指定家具传统图案三维模型及相关数据信息,解决了立体图案照片或二维图案在造型上表现力不足的问题,更人性化、直观化地为图案研究者及设计者服务。

关键词:蒙古族家具;三维模型;数据库

中图分类号:TP311 文献标识码:A 文章编号:1009-3044(2016)32-0005-02

The Mongolian Traditional Furniture Construction of 3 d Model Database

ZHANG Shi-zheng, BAO Li-mei

(Inner Mongolia University for Nationalities, Tongliao 028043, China)

Abstract: Based on the collecting and organizing existing on the basis of the Mongolian traditional furniture design, use of computer graphics, digital image processing, AutoCAD and 3D animation design method, the collected data using AutoCAD 2D pattern to create, create 3D model by using 3Ds MAX, let furniture design researchers very convenient, intuitive to watch model and three-dimensional decorative pattern. Through the establishment of the database, can facilitate query and export specifies the traditional furniture design 3D model and related data, solves the three-dimensional design pictures or two-dimensional pattern is the problem of insufficient expression on modelling, more humanized and visualizations to serve design researchers and designers.

Key words: The Mongolian furniture; 3D model; database

通过对蒙古族传统家具图案的维度特性进行分析,得出图案总是依附于家具本体或单独充当家具部件的规律,因此多以三维维度特性出现,即三维空间图案。而我们现在所看到的家具中的图案多以二维形式出现,如照片、宣传资料等,由于图片在空间尺度和空间表现力方面存在缺陷,使图案研究者和设计者对家具中的三维图案不能清晰获得空间感知,必须借助对实物的实际观测来获取完整的三维数据,所以建立一套三维图案数据库势在必行。

1 数据库总体设计

蒙古族传统家具的装饰性主要体现在家具面板上的装饰图案和家具结构部件两个方面,前者多为平面装饰图案,后者多为空间立体图案。家具部件的装饰呈现出来的花色是多样的,表现形式、手法也各不相同。有纹理与色泽发生变化的,有使用线脚的,有雕刻的,有镶嵌的、有挂铜饰件的,甚至有的家具用到了攒接与斗簇,这些装饰手法极大丰富了蒙古族传统家具的内涵,这些立体的装饰手法,二维数据库虽然能说明一些结构关系,但毕竟还是有局限的,三维数据库便可弥补这一点。而蒙古族传统家具的形制通过三维模型来进行展示可以得到更加直观的效果,在展示时可以切换浏览的角度,从各个方面进行观察,从而解决了立体图案照片或二维图案在造型上表现力不足的问题。

1.1 总体设计思路

三维数据库基本的功能有: 用戶浏览、数据查询、数据编辑、数据导出等四个部分,如图1所示。

图1 总体设计图

三维模型数据库系统运行流程分为三部分:创建、维护和运行。首先是创建数据库,根据搜集、整理现有蒙古族传统家具图案进行三维建模,由于主要是体现蒙古族传统家具和蒙古族美术图案的特点,也就是体现外观的特点,并不要求对家具内部零部件进行精确重现,所以在此建模主要使用的是3D Max,而不是Solidworks。其次是数据维护阶段,管理员对创建好的模型进行分类管理,方便一般用户查询以及导出。管理员还可对数据模型进行添加、修改和删除等操作。最后数据库运行时,一般用户可以登录对三维模型进行查询和导出。

1.2 数据结构模型

蒙古族传统家具模型在建模时需先构建三维模型,而蒙古族家具由家具结构、家具装饰构成。家具结构和家具装饰主要利用建模完成,而家具装饰来源于家具图案,家具装饰的材质主要由材质和贴图来赋予。那在分析三维模型数据库结构时就需注意,其数据结构相关属性如表1所示。

表1 数据相关属性

2 蒙古族家具三维模型构建方法

2.1 绘制草图

根据搜集、整理的蒙古族家具和家具装饰的尺寸进行绘制,创建几何线条形状,得到精确的设计图。以茶桌为例,如图2所示,茶桌以红色为主,有些桌面绘有图案。有雕刻的茶桌其雕刻部分较简单,常见回形纹。茶桌直腿居多,三弯腿以内翻为主。大部分茶桌无屉。现绘制一茶桌草图,边长355mm,高220mm,深350mm,只能供一个人喝茶,草图如图3所示。

2.2 创建模型

2.3 赋予材质和贴图

利用搜集来的蒙古族传统美术图案和材质编辑器为家具、家具装饰分别赋予恰当的材质和贴图,如图6所示。

现在得到的家具三维模型可以通过不同角度进行了浏览,方便用户使用。

3 局限性

3.1 样本的全面性

蒙古族传统家具一直未受重视,导致遗存实物较少且保存不完善。在创建三维模型数据库时样本不够齐全,缺漏较多。

3.2 历史资料缺失

历史中对蒙古族传统家具的史料记载较少;用于保存并介绍蒙古族传统家具的博物馆等场所较少,获取资料不易;对各个时期、各个地域的蒙古族传统家具进行分类比较困难。

4 结束语

通过建立数据库,可以方便查询和导出指定家具三维模型及相关数据信息,为进一步的研究奠定基础。使用数据库、三维数字技术对蒙古族传统家具实行了信息化和数字化处理,为蒙古族家具部件上的装饰研究和设计提供了良好的数字化基础性服务,解决了立体图案照片或二维图案在造型上表现力不足的问题,更人性化、直观化地为图案研究者及设计者服务。

参考文献:

[1] 王丽,宋奎彦. 蒙古族传统家具造型特色研究[J].美与时代,2010,(7):93-95.

[2] 董晓红. 蒙古族传统家具装饰图案网络数据库系统的研究与开发[D].内蒙古农业大学,2011.

[3] 张云阁. 蒙古族传统家具的彩绘研究[D].内蒙古大学,2012.

[4] 江能兴,周淦淼. 基于3DS MAX的三维模型的优化研究[J]. 计算机与数字工程,2012(4):142-145

[5] 李军. 蒙古族传统家具结构特征研究[D].内蒙古农业大学,2013.

[6] 王伟荣. 家具产品的三维展示设计与实现[D].上海交通大学,2013.

[7] 贺春光, 高晓霞. 创建蒙古族传统家具三维图案数据库的研究[J].内蒙古农业大学学报, 2011,32(1): 245-249.

[8] 張胜欢. 基于Solidworks的明式家具三位参数化模型库的研究[D]. 南京林业大学,2015.